Organon & Co. (NYSE:OGN – Get Free Report) has been given a consensus rating of “Reduce” by the seven ratings firms that are presently covering the firm, MarketBeat.com reports. Two investment analysts have rated the stock with a sell recommendation and five have assigned a hold recommendation to the company. The average 1 year price target among analysts that have covered the stock in the last year is $11.40.
OGN has been the topic of a number of recent analyst reports. Piper Sandler upgraded shares of Organon & Co. from an “underweight” rating to a “neutral” rating and boosted their price target for the company from $5.00 to $14.00 in a research report on Tuesday, April 28th. Weiss Ratings lowered shares of Organon & Co. from a “hold (c)” rating to a “hold (c-)” rating in a report on Monday. BNP Paribas Exane reiterated a “neutral” rating and issued a $14.00 target price (up from $12.00) on shares of Organon & Co. in a research note on Wednesday, April 29th. Finally, Zacks Research raised Organon & Co. from a “strong sell” rating to a “hold” rating in a report on Tuesday, April 14th.

Organon & Co. Trading Up 0.1%
Organon & Co. stock opened at $13.57 on Thursday. Organon & Co. has a 12 month low of $5.69 and a 12 month high of $13.60. The stock has a market cap of $3.56 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 17.63,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.26 and a beta of 1.55. The business has a 50 day moving average price of $13.48 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$10.52. The company has a quick ratio of 1.42, a current ratio of 1.95 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 8.43.
Organon & Co. Announces Dividend
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, September 10th. Stockholders of record on Friday, August 14th will be paid a dividend of $0.02 per share. This represents a $0.08 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.6%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, August 14th. Organon & Co.’s dividend payout ratio is 10.39%.
Organon & Co. Company Profile
Organon & Co is a global healthcare company that was established as an independent, publicly traded entity following its spin-off from Merck & Co in June 2021. Headquartered in Jersey City, New Jersey, Organon focuses on delivering therapeutic solutions across women’s health, biosimilars, and established brands. The company’s creation reflected a strategic effort to concentrate on specialty pharmaceuticals and legacy products with proven patient impact.
In women’s health, Organon provides a broad portfolio of products addressing reproductive and gynecological conditions, including fertility treatments, contraception, and hormone replacement therapies.
